Table saws - buyers guide please....
In the market for a small sub £200 table saw. EBay has a Scheppach HS100m for 170, a woodstar st10e for 145.
Others are also available. I want to produce some modified sash window sections with an internal angle which I don't think I can do with a router & table, but two cuts - one at an angle should do it I think. Also be a lot quicker to do other sections with cuts rather than endless routing passes... At this level is there much to choose between? Other ads mention "sliding carriages" or similar, does this offer any real advantages? TIA Jim K |
